Role Summary
The Lab @ T. Rowe Price is seeking a proactive, energetic, and highly organized self-starter Office Manager with a strong client-service mindset to support senior leadership and act as a polished representative of our technology-driven business.
This role is ideal for someone who thrives in fast-paced environments, anticipates needs before they arise, and seamlessly balances multiple priorities while creating an exceptional experience for both internal stakeholders and external clients.
The successful candidate is a natural problem solver, a relationship builder, and a true “go-getter” who confidently wears many hats elevating leaders, strengthening office culture, and ensuring every visitor and team member feels supported.
Responsibilities
Executive & Leadership Support:
- Provide high-quality, anticipatory support to senior leaders, helping them stay organized, prepared, and focused.
- Manage complex calendars and scheduling, including resolving conflicts and coordinating priorities across stakeholders.
- Monitor and manage executive inboxes, draft and refine communications, and follow up proactively on action items.
- Prepare leaders for meetings by organizing materials, gathering documents, prepping logistics, and ensuring seamless execution.
- Serve as a trusted partner for executives by offering sound judgment, clear communication, and professional discretion.
Client Experience & Office Presence:
- Create a warm, professional, and client-focused environment greeting and hosting visitors, clients, and partners with hospitality.
- Serve as the face of the office and ambassador of our brand, ensuring all interactions reflect professionalism and service excellence.
- Anticipate client and guest needs, elevate their experience, and provide white-glove support during meetings and events.
Event & Meeting Support:
- Lead the coordination and execution of internal and external events from team gatherings to client visits and leadership meetings.
- Own logistics end-to-end, including space planning, materials, catering, technology coordination, and on-site support.
- Bring creativity, polish, and attention to detail to ensure memorable, high-quality event experiences.
Travel & Logistics:
- Coordinate complex domestic and international travel for executives, including itineraries, accommodations, and transportation.
- Prepare expense reports and ensure timely, accurate reimbursement submissions.
Records, Operations & Office Management:
- Maintain organized records, documents, and files, ensuring confidentiality and accuracy.
- Oversee office operations, supplies, vendor management, and various administrative workflows.
- Identify opportunities to streamline processes and improve efficiency across the office.
Organization & Problem Solving:
- Balance and prioritize multiple deadlines with exceptional attention to detail.
- Navigate shifting demands gracefully and maintain strong follow-through.
- Bring solutions, not problems anticipating issues and resolving them proactively.
Relationship Building & Stakeholder Engagement:
- Build strong relationships with internal teams, business partners, and external stakeholders.
- Foster a positive, collaborative office culture and support initiatives that strengthen employee engagement.
- Represent leadership and the office with professionalism, integrity, and a service-oriented approach.
